How much do assistant operator j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 10, 2026, the average hourly pay for assistant operator in Tennessee is $17.99,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$13.94 and $20.29 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are some common challenges Assistant Operators face during shift changes, and how can they be managed effectively?

Assistant Operators often encounter challenges during shift changes, such as incomplete handovers or miscommunication about ongoing tasks. To manage these effectively, it’s important to follow standardized handover procedures, maintain accurate and up-to-date logs, and communicate proactively with both outgoing and incoming team members. Building strong teamwork and attention to detail helps ensure a smooth transition and minimizes operational disruptions.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an Assistant Operator,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Assistant Operator, you need a basic understanding of machinery operation, safety protocols, and often a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with industrial equipment, control panels, and sometimes certifications like OSHA safety training are typically required. Attention to detail, reliability, and good teamwork skills help you excel in supporting smooth operations. These skills ensure safe, efficient production processes and help maintain workplace safety and productivity.

What is the difference between Assistant Operator vs Machine Operator?

AspectAssistant OperatorMachine Operator
CredentialsHigh school diploma, on-the-job trainingHigh school diploma, technical certification often preferred
Work EnvironmentAssists in setup, monitoring, and maintenance of machineryOperates machinery directly, responsible for production output
Industry UsageCommon in manufacturing, construction, and industrial plantsPrimarily in manufacturing, processing, and production facilities

Assistant Operators support Machine Operators by preparing equipment and monitoring processes, while Machine Operators handle the direct operation of machinery. Both roles require similar credentials and are vital in industrial settings, but Machine Operators have more responsibility for operating equipment independently.

What are Assistant Operators?

Assistant Operators are entry-level professionals who support the operation of machinery or equipment in industries such as manufacturing, energy, or logistics. They work under the supervision of senior operators to help monitor processes, perform basic maintenance, and ensure safety protocols are followed. Their responsibilities may include setting up machines, loading materials, inspecting products, and reporting any issues to supervisors. Assistant Operators play a key role in maintaining efficient production and minimizing downtime. This position is often a stepping stone to more advanced operator roles.

The Assistant Bag Machine Operator's is responsible for assisting in the overall operation of the machine ensuring the quality and efficiency of the bags created by the bag machines. The primary responsibility consists of assisting the operator in running and managing the machine that automatically measures, prints, cuts, folds, and glues, or seals to form bags.
Essential Duties and Tasks:
To perform this job successfully, an individual must be able to assist the operator in each essential job function satisfactorily. Reasonable accommodations may be made, upon request, to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.
  • Assist operator in threading materials from parent roll through guides and rollers to cutters, gluer, printer, folding device, or electric sealer.
  • Assist in starting machine, observes operation, and adjusts machine to ensure uniform shearing, printing, folding, gluing, or sealing of continuous roll of material into finished bags.
  • May insert shaft into core of parent roll and secure with steel collars, using hand tools, and mount roll onto
    machine, using hoist.
  • Assist in Operating machine in proper manner, maintaining high production and a quality product, with minimum waste, while maintaining set goals of machine speeds
  • References work orders for paper supply, and requisitions paper from the warehouse when necessary.
  • Assists in diagnosing problems on machines and corrects immediately, to keep smooth production flow.
  • Performs daily maintenance on machine including: oiling machine, cleaning drum area of machine, re-taping, and scraping down.
  • Communicates well with other operators and teammates at shift change.
  • Adheres and maintains equipment to all GMP and SQF regulations at all times.
  • Ability to multi-task as well as work in a fast-paced manufacturing environment
